NBC says of “Bus Tour”:
Leslie goes on a bus tour for the final day of her campaign, and is caught off guard when an important person in Pawnee passes away. Meanwhile, Andy susses out a security threat, and Chris finds an unlikely cure for his depression.

* Andy spends most of the episode as his fake-FBI alter-ego
Burt Macklin. He assigns highly sexual code-names to most of the regular characters. His crime-solving bulletin board cracked me up, as did a violent crime re-enactment.
* We are reminded that at least three beautiful women elected not to be Chris’ girlfriend this season.
* In her stump speech, Leslie references a comedian who’s been dead since 2004.
* Leslie’s tour bus is full of sexy dancers in hot pants.
* If I’m not mistaken, “Yes Dear” icon Mike O’Malley turns up this week.
* The delightfully absent Perd Hapley returns, as does Bobby Newport (Paul Rudd) and his expensive campaign manager Jennifer Barkley (Kathryn Hahn).
